Freedom, Distribution and Work from Home: Rereading Engels in the Time of the COVID-19-Pandemic
The aim of this paper is to understand the emerging practices of work from home drawing from the works of Friedrich Engels. Situating the rising debate on work from home, particularly in the context of the COVID-19 pandemic, this article revisits some of the texts by Friedrich Engels to understand...
